All the rich, aromatic flavour of a classic tikka masala — made lighter with low-fat yogurt and a tomato-based sauce. Serve with cauliflower rice to keep it under 400 kcal.

High ProteinGluten Free

Ingredients

  • 600g chicken breast, cubed
  • 150g low-fat natural yogurt
  • 2 tbsp tikka masala paste
  • 1 onion, finely diced
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tsp fresh ginger, grated
  • 400g tin chopped tomatoes
  • 100ml reduced-fat coconut milk
  • 1 tsp garam masala
  • 1 tbsp vegetable oil
  • Fresh coriander to serve

Method

  1. 1

    Mix chicken with yogurt and 1 tbsp tikka paste. Marinate 30 minutes (or overnight).

  2. 2

    Grill or pan-fry chicken pieces over high heat until charred and cooked through. Set aside.

  3. 3

    Heat oil in a pan, soften onion 5 minutes. Add garlic, ginger, and remaining paste, cook 2 minutes.

  4. 4

    Add chopped tomatoes and simmer 10 minutes until thickened.

  5. 5

    Stir in coconut milk and garam masala. Add chicken and simmer 5 minutes.

  6. 6

    Scatter with coriander and serve with cauliflower rice or 60g cooked basmati.

Tip: Cauliflower rice instead of basmati saves around 120 kcal per serving.
